About Mahuli Village
Mahuli is a village in Wadrafnagar tehsil in district of Surguja, Chhattisgarh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Mahuli was 2,179 which includes 1,067 males and 1,112 females. Mahuli covers 824.74 ha area. Pincode of Mahuli is 497225.
